I have a PC with Windows Server 2003 configured as DNS.

The zone controlled by this server is HOME.DESYTEC.COM and DESYTEC.COM is
controlled by an external DNS Server.

All people (from Internet and from my LAN) can connect to my PC using its
name (I have a web server and a mail server). And when they ping my PC, for
example, PING WWW.DESYTEC.COM they see that the current IP address is:
200.119.231.211, which is correct. The PING report that IP even in the PC's
in my LAN.

The problem is when I ping WWW.DESYTEC.COM from the server. It reports an IP
address that I had before (I had dynamic IP), for example,

C:\>PING WWW.DESYTEC.COM

Pinging www.desytec.com [200.119.233.152] with 32 bytes of data:

Why only the server reports an invalid IP? how can I update them? do I need
to do that every time my IP changes?
